📅  最后修改于: 2023-12-03 15:17:58.370000             🧑  作者: Mango
在开发 Node.js 应用时,我们经常需要在代码更改后手动重启服务器。这种重复的操作非常低效且令人烦恼。Nodemon 可以解决这个问题,在代码发生更改时自动重启 Node.js 应用程序。本文将介绍如何使用 Nodemon 脚本来自动启动和监控 Node.js 应用程序。
首先,你需要在你的机器上安装 Nodemon。你可以使用以下命令来安装 Nodemon:
npm install -g nodemon
这将通过 npm 全局安装 Nodemon。
要使用 Nodemon 脚本,你需要在运行 Node.js 应用程序之前使用它。首先,在项目的根目录中创建一个 shell 脚本,然后将以下内容复制到脚本中:
nodemon app.js
以上命令将自动监控 app.js
文件的变化,并在文件发生更改时自动重启服务器。
你也可以在命令后面加上更多的参数来定制 Nodemon 的行为。例如,你可以使用以下命令以静默模式下启动服务器:
nodemon app.js --quiet
还可以使用以下命令,以在发生错误时更快速地重启服务器:
nodemon app.js --ignore public/
使用 Nodemon 可以使 Node.js 应用程序的开发过程更加高效。无需手动重启服务器,当代码发生变化时,Nodemon 将自动重启服务器,让你的开发流程更加流畅。安装和使用 Nodemon 脚本非常简单,在你的项目中试试看吧!